.1 min read Last Improved: Sep 19 2024|12:48 AM IST.The economical liberalisation that started in the 1990s seems to be to have benefited Gujarat, Haryana, Karnataka, Tamil Nadu and Delhi the best as their share in the national GDP has actually raised substantially in between 1990-91 and also 2023-24, according to an operating paper due to the Economic Advisory Authorities to the Prime Minister (EAC-PM).Maharashtra's share in the national GDP dropped from 14.6 percent in 1990-91 to 13.3 per-cent in 2023-24. It still sustains the leading area amongst states. Though Tamil Nadu's portion declined, from 8.7 percent in 1960-61 to 7.1 per-cent in 1990-91, it observed a turn-around, with its own share in the nationwide GDP touching 8.9 per cent in 2023-24. Gujarat also found a turnaround in its own luck along with its own allotment touching 8.1 percent in 2022-23 from 6.4 percent in 1990-91.Bengaluru's surge as an innovation center found Karnataka's portion rise coming from 5.3 per cent in 1990-91 to 8.2 per cent in 2023-24.Very First Published: Sep 19 2024|12:47 AM IST.
